Boston's climate demands special attention during camera installation and system design.
Heavy winter snow, freeze-thaw cycles, spring rain, summer humidity, and coastal salt spray challenge surveillance equipment. Our installations use heated camera housings, wide-range temperature ratings, and moisture-resistant cabling to maintain reliability year-round.

Residential installations on private property typically don't require permits, but commercial projects often need electrical permits if new wiring is installed. We check your property type and inform you of any Boston building code requirements before starting.
Cloud storage plans vary—some offer rolling 30-day access, others allow months of archived footage. We discuss your retention needs during setup so you can store footage long enough for insurance claims, investigations, or dispute resolution.

Local recording continues even if internet is down—footage stores on your recorder or NVR. Remote viewing and cloud backup pause until connectivity restores. We design systems to keep recording running regardless of internet status.
